§ 27880. — 27880. (Amended by Stats. 2016, Ch. 41, Sec. 1.)

California·Code PEN Penal Code - PEN·Div. 6.·Title 4.·Part 6. DIVISION 6. SALE, LEASE, OR TRANSFER OF FIREARMS·Ch. 4. CHAPTER 4. Crimes Relating to Sale, Lease, or Transfer of Firearms·Art. 6. ARTICLE 6. Exceptions to the Requirement of Using a Dealer for a Private Party Firearms Transaction

Section 27545 does not apply to the loan of a firearm if all of the following requirements are satisfied:

(a)The loan is to a spouse, registered domestic partner, or any of the following relations, whether by consanguinity, adoption, or steprelation:
(1)Parent.
(2)Child.
(3)Sibling.
(4)Grandparent.
(5)Grandchild.
(b)The loan is infrequent, as defined in Section 16730.
(c)The loan is for any lawful purpose.
(d)The loan does not exceed 30 days in duration.
(e)Until January 1, 2015, if the firearm is a handgun, the individual being loaned the firearm shall have a valid handgun safety certificate.
